1. Oxidation number and balancing redox equations

Exam focus: Oxygen isn't always −2: it's −1 in peroxides (H₂O₂), −1/2 in superoxides (KO₂), and +2 in OF₂, where fluorine is the more electronegative atom — NEET tests exactly these exceptions, not the default. Also watch for disproportionation, where the same element is simultaneously oxidised and reduced in one reaction, such as Cl₂ with cold dilute NaOH.

2. Types of redox reactions

Exam focus: Whether one species can oxidise another is decided by E°cell = E°(reduction of the oxidiser) − E°(reduction of the reducing agent) coming out positive — that's how "will X displace Y" questions are actually meant to be solved, not from a memorised reactivity list. Disproportionation (one element both oxidised and reduced) and its reverse, comproportionation, are the classification names NEET most often asks you to apply correctly.
